摘要

In the process of international socialization, states are induced to adopt the constitutive norms and rules of the international community. This thesis examines the process of norm transfer by International Organizations (IOs), specifically the European Union (EU) and NATO. Generally, international norms are diffused through IO enlargement or, as an alternative, through the partnership between the organization and non-member states. The ultimate success of the socialization process depends on the strategies, mechanisms, and tools that are used by each socializing agent. The effectiveness of IOs' norms diffusion in dealing with partners is greater when the organizations apply differentiated, multi-staged socialization strategies that imply various levels of conditionality and offer powerful incentives that encourage domestic transformation. The general goal of the thesis is to assess the effectiveness of the European Neighborhood Policy (ENP) and the Partnership for Peace Program (PfP) as two substitute mechanisms of enlargement through which the EU and NATO diffuse their norms to states that aspire to cooperation, affiliation, or full membership. Particular attention in the present study will be paid to the ENP and PfP's impact on two East European countries: Moldova and Ukraine. The results show that, despite all positive achievements and results to date, the European Neighborhood Policy as a norm diffusion mechanism is less effective than the Partnership for Peace Program, and it could be improved by more actively applying the PfP's experience. The thesis contributes to the assessment of the impact of EU and NATO policies towards their East European neighbors who currently do not have the immediate perspective of full membership.
